Diokno urges LGUs to step up spending; cites budget surplus

Published Nov 28, 2023 08:26 am

Department of Finance (DOF) Secretary Benjamin Diokno is asking local government units (LGUs) to speed up their spending given their budget surplus because of the lack of investments.

Speaking during a Palace press briefing on Tuesday, Nov. 28, the official said that LGUs are in a “surplus position” while the national government is in “deficit.”

This, he added, had always been the case because LGUs “are not inclined to invest in some activities” despite being allowed to borrow money from banks.

“So, we requested also the President to encourage local government units to expand its revenue sources and boost spending to support local and national growth,” he explained, adding that government corporations such as the Government Service Insurance System (GSIS) and the Social Security System (SSS) must also boost their spending.

The DOF chief attended the sectoral meeting, which President Marcos presided over in Malacañang discussing the economics prospects for next year.

He lamented that despite being in a surplus position with their budget, “the LGUs continue to be dependent on the national transfer despite its broad powers to raise sources of revenue.”

“Lagi silang nakaasa sa (They are always dependent on the) transfer from the national government and hindi nila ang tawag namin (and they are not, what we call) low absorptive capacity to improve the quality of public goods and services that they are supposed to deliver,” Diokno said.

“So, kumbaga sinasabi natin sa LGUs ‘Bilis-bilisan naman ninyo ang paggastos ng pera’ (So, it’s like we’re telling the LGUs ‘Hasten up your spending’),” he added.

Diokno explained that LGUs have not been traditionally spending as much as the national government despite being in a position to do so.

“That’s always been the problem. Ever since, I can remember, the LGUs are in surplus position whereas the national government is in a deficit position. And noon time namin (During our time), I think one of the reasons is that, the LGUs by nature or LGU officials by nature are kind of shy to invest in some projects,” he said.

Although LGUs are allowed to borrow money from banks, the official stressed that they are not inclined to do so because their term is only for three years.

He furthered that local chief executives would need to spend one year in feasibility study and research before presenting the proposal to a lender.

By the third year, despite the possibility of being granted the loan, local chief executives would be preparing for reelection.

“So, tatakbo naman siya ng reelection wala pa siyang napapakita, pero may utang siya. So, mga baka ganoong isyu (So, he’s going to run for elections but he has nothing to show, he has debt even. So, those are the issues),” he added.

The DOF chief also recognized the problem with “hiring” because LGUs have a hard time attracting personnel.

“So, in response, I think we are going to tap the Development Academy on the Philippines and the Local Government Academy to train people who may actually be instrumental in investing in some local government activities,” he said.
